Что такое акустический режим жесткого диска

Обновлено: 21.11.2024

Злоумышленники могут использовать звуковые волны, чтобы помешать нормальному режиму работы жесткого диска, создавая временный или постоянный отказ в состоянии (DoS), который можно использовать для предотвращения записи видеоматериалов системами видеонаблюдения или зависания компьютеров, выполняющих критические операции.

Основной принцип этой атаки заключается в том, что звуковые волны вызывают механические вибрации в пластинах хранения данных жесткого диска. Если звук воспроизводится на определенной частоте, создается эффект резонанса, который усиливает эффект вибрации.

Поскольку жесткие диски хранят огромное количество информации в небольших областях каждой пластины, они запрограммированы на остановку всех операций чтения/записи во время вибрации пластины, чтобы избежать царапин на дисках и необратимого повреждения жесткого диска.

Использование звуков для прерывания работы жесткого диска – не новая идея, она уже обсуждалась в предыдущих исследованиях, проводившихся почти десятилетие назад.

Еще в 2008 году нынешний технический директор Joyent Брэндон Грегг показал, как громкие звуки вызывают ошибки чтения/записи жестких дисков в центре обработки данных, в печально известном видеоролике "Крики в центре обработки данных". Ранее в этом году аргентинский исследователь продемонстрировал, как он заставил жесткий диск временно перестать реагировать на команды ОС, воспроизводя сигнал с частотой 130 Гц.

Новое исследование показывает практичность акустических атак на жесткие диски

На прошлой неделе ученые из Принстонского университета и Университета Пердью опубликовали новое исследование по этой теме, дополнив предыдущие выводы результатами дополнительных практических испытаний.

Исследовательская группа использовала специально созданный испытательный стенд для подачи звуковых волн на жесткий диск под разными углами, записывая результаты для определения частоты звука, времени атаки, расстояния от жесткого диска и угла звуковой волны, при котором жесткий диск останавливается. работает.

У исследователей не возникло трудностей с определением оптимальных частотных диапазонов атак для четырех жестких дисков Western Digital, которые они использовали в своих экспериментах.

Они также утверждали, что у злоумышленников также не возникнет проблем с исследованием и обнаружением диапазонов атак для жестких дисков, на которые они хотят нацелиться.

Исследователи говорят, что любой злоумышленник, который может генерировать акустические сигналы вблизи систем хранения данных на жестких дисках, имеет в своем распоряжении простое место атаки для саботажа компаний или отдельных лиц.

Акустические атаки можно проводить несколькими способами

Атакующий может либо подать сигнал с помощью внешнего динамика, либо использовать динамик рядом с целью. С этой целью злоумышленник может потенциально воспользоваться удаленным использованием программного обеспечения (например, дистанционно управлять мультимедийным программным обеспечением в автомобиле или персональном устройстве), обманом заставить пользователя воспроизвести вредоносный звук, прикрепленный к электронному письму или веб-странице, или внедрить вредоносный звук в широко распространенном мультимедиа (например, в телерекламе).

После того, как злоумышленник найдет способ проведения акустической атаки, ее результаты будут зависеть от ряда условий.

Например, чем ближе динамик к жесткому диску, тем меньше времени требуется для проведения атаки. Чем дольше длится атака, тем больше шансов, что она приведет к постоянному отказу в обслуживании, требующему перезагрузки устройства, а не к временной проблеме, после которой устройство сможет восстановиться самостоятельно.

Кроме того, злоумышленникам необходимо обратить особое внимание на то, чтобы в поле зрения не было людей-операторов, поскольку атаки происходят в пределах слышимости человеческого уха, и жертвы могут выяснить происхождение монотонного звука и потенциально связать его присутствие со сбоями в работе. локальные устройства.

Исследователи из Принстона и Пердью провели акустические атаки на жесткие диски, обнаруженные в устройствах DVR (цифровой видеомагнитофон), используемых для систем видеонаблюдения (замкнутого телевидения), а также на настольных компьютерах под управлением Windows 10, Ubuntu 16 и Fedora 27. .

Атаки на системы видеонаблюдения

«Примерно через 230 секунд после начала акустической атаки на мониторе появилось всплывающее окно с сообщением «Диск потерян!»», — рассказали исследователи об акустической атаке на жесткие диски DVR.

"После отключения звука мы попытались воспроизвести записанное видео с четырех камер и обнаружили, что запись была прервана", – сообщили исследователи."Для решения этой проблемы видеорегистратор пришлось перезапустить, но видеозапись была безвозвратно утеряна."

Атаки на компьютеры

Второй эксперимент был нацелен на настольные ПК. Исследователи воспроизвели звук частотой 9,1 кГц с расстояния 25 сантиметров по направлению к вентиляционному отверстию корпуса.

"Это вызвало различного рода сбои на работающем ПК", – заявила исследовательская группа, обнаружив, что они даже вызывали ошибки BSOD, приводившие к сбою основных операционных систем, если звук воспроизводился в течение более продолжительного времени.

Необходима акустическая защита HDD

Большинство этих атак основано на воспроизведении вредоносных звуков с близкого расстояния. Но исследователи не считают это проблемой. «Использование более мощных источников звука может соответственно увеличить
дальность атаки», — сказали они.

«Безопасность жестких дисков не принималась во внимание, несмотря на их критическую роль в вычислительных системах. Жесткие диски содержат важные программные компоненты (например, операционную систему) и различные формы конфиденциальной информации (например, записи с камер видеонаблюдения) и, таким образом, могут быть привлекательной мишенью для множества злоумышленников", — говорят исследователи.

Массовая эксплуатация реальных устройств с использованием акустических атак на жесткие диски маловероятна, поскольку такой сценарий, скорее всего, нецелесообразен из-за множества критериев, которым должен соответствовать злоумышленник.

Тем не менее акустические атаки по своей сути подходят для целенаправленных атак на тщательно отобранные критически важные системы. Например, акустические атаки могут помочь в атаках, спонсируемых государством, помочь с физическим вторжением в защищенные системы, испортить или саботировать сбор криминалистических данных или даже привести к гибели людей при атаке на жесткие диски, используемые медицинскими устройствами.

Для изучения сценария, не вошедшего в исследовательский документ, банда вредоносных программ для банкоматов может провести акустическую атаку на банкомат, чтобы помешать ему временно собирать доказательства судебной экспертизы, пока бесфайловое вредоносное ПО выполняется в оперативной памяти банкомата и выдает наличные деньги злоумышленникам. Этот сценарий и многие другие существуют.

Читатели Bleeping Computer могут узнать больше об акустических атаках на жесткие диски в исследовательской статье Shahrad et al. "Акустические атаки типа "отказ в обслуживании" на жесткие диски".

Хотя все жесткие диски поддерживают ту или иную форму настраиваемого управления питанием с первых дней существования ATA-4 (UltraDMA/33), автоматическое управление акустикой (AAM) поддерживается с момента появления ATA-6 (UltraATA/100). . В случае управления питанием значение от 1 до 254 определяет уровень энергосбережения. Возьмем простой пример: если вы останетесь ниже 128, жесткий диск автоматически остановит двигатель шпинделя после определенного времени простоя. Обратите внимание, что это не имеет ничего общего с управлением питанием операционной системы, которое больше подходит для повседневной работы, поскольку оно учитывает приложения и рабочие нагрузки.

Почему шум является такой проблемой

Хотя это может отличаться от одного человека к другому, общий человеческий слух ограничен частотным диапазоном примерно от 20 Гц до 20 кГц с повышенной чувствительностью к определенным частотам. Большинство людей очень хорошо слышат частоты от 1 кГц до 3 кГц, а это означает, что уменьшение шума только в этом частотном диапазоне имеет большее значение, чем попытки изолировать или уменьшить другие частоты. Здесь начинается управление акустикой.

Большая часть звуковых волн в диапазоне от 1 до 3 кГц состоит из шума от двух разных источников. Во-первых, это шум жесткого диска, вызванный двигателем шпинделя и трением внутри диска. Этот шум обычно можно уменьшить только путем модификации компонентов жесткого диска. Однако второй, составляющий большую часть воспринимаемого нами шума, вызван вибрацией между жестким диском и корпусом компьютера. Это, в свою очередь, состоит из вращательной вибрации, вызванной двигателем шпинделя, а также вибрационного шума от головок чтения/записи, которые многократно ускоряются и тормозят в секунду.

Самый быстрый способ перемещения головок – это разогнать их в направлении новой дорожки до тех пор, пока не будет пройдена половина расстояния, а затем замедлить движение головок, пока они не достигнут места назначения. Существует несколько вариантов изменения этой операции, начиная с изменения ускорения и торможения, а также требуемой импульсной мощности. Добавление к уравнению собственной очереди команд, которая анализирует и переупорядочивает все входящие команды, чтобы найти наиболее эффективный порядок обработки, помогает уменьшить движение головы, что может улучшить как время доступа, так и шум доступа.

Инструменты ААМ

В Интернете доступно несколько утилит для изменения настроек AAM. Hitachi, чью Deskstar 7K1000.B мы использовали в этой статье, предоставляет свой собственный Feature Tool 2.11. Программное обеспечение мощное, так как вы можете изменять параметры кэша, режимы передачи, энергопотребление и настройки интерфейса, но оно основано на DOS и требует выполнения из командной строки и запуска вашей системы с загрузочной 3,5-дюймовой дискеты или образа компакт-диска. Изображение и Feature Tool 2.11 доступны на странице загрузки Hitachi. Это относится не только к Hitachi. Мы нашли похожие приложения командной строки от производителей жестких дисков Samsung и Seagate. Другие инструменты, такие как HDD Acoustic Manager от Abacus, AAM Tool, Hard Disk Sentinel и другие, написаны для более удобного использования.

WinAAM

Мы решили использовать один из самых простых найденных инструментов: WinAAM. Версия 2.9 является самой последней версией и хорошо работает с нашим приводом Hitachi. Он ничего не делает, кроме установки параметров AAM либо на тихий (значение 128), либо на громкий (254), что соответствует максимальной производительности. Это именно то, что нам нужно, так как это позволило нам проверить производительность, акустику и энергопотребление с использованием двух крайних настроек.

Статус Эта тема была заблокирована и не открыта для дальнейших ответов. Первоначальный инициатор темы может использовать кнопку «Отчет», чтобы запросить ее повторное открытие, но любой другой пользователь с похожей проблемой должен создать новую тему. Посмотрите наше приветственное руководство, чтобы узнать, как пользоваться этим сайтом.

vookster82

Просто ищу мнения об акустических режимах жесткого диска. У меня Dimension 8400, и в биосе есть возможность изменить акустический режим / уровень звука дисков IDE. Вариант, который у меня есть сейчас для «производительности», кажется намного лучше для скорости, но он заставляет HD звучать так, как будто ему 5 лет. в то время как настройка по умолчанию (производитель диска) была явно медленнее, но я не слышал, как шлифуется HD. Любые мысли или знания/опыт по этому вопросу? Должен ли я держаться подальше от варианта производительности? Это сжигает мои HD? Большинство данных, которые я получил, меня не беспокоят, а то, о чем я беспокоюсь, я часто делаю резервными копиями.

Спасибо, что прочитали

кронус

Я бы оставил его в режиме производительности из-за скорости и просто следил за диском. Нет ничего хуже, чем взорвать диск и потерять все эти данные. Продолжайте делать резервные копии, но я уверен, что диск проживет долгую жизнь.

Сэр Кенин

Режим производительности просто означает, что он работает в соответствии со спецификацией. Не о чем беспокоиться и не на что обращать внимание. Некоторые жесткие диски шумнее других, вот и все. Некоторые из них похожи на полировщики камней, которыми вы пользовались в детстве, другие почти бесшумны по своим характеристикам.

Настройка по умолчанию фактически немного замедляет вращение диска, из-за чего вы теряете производительность. Я бы сам не стал использовать этот вариант. Имейте в виду, что у меня в этом офисе достаточно компьютеров и вентиляторов, и я не услышу звук большого самолета, если он пролетит над головой.

vookster82

Спасибо, что успокоили меня. Я полагал, что биос был настроен таким образом от Dell специально, чтобы неграмотные люди не звонили в Dell и не говорили: «Мой жесткий диск скрипит, я думаю, он сломался». Похоже на то, как Dell не включает гиперпоточность в настройках BIOS на многих новых компьютерах. Конечно, я не думаю, что это действительно помогает в любом случае. я никогда не замечал разницы, но я все еще думаю, что это действительно зависит от типа используемых приложений.

Я копался на вкладке "Информация" и включил "Управление акустикой", но не могу его отключить. Возможно ли это?

Кроме того, есть ли способ проверить заводские настройки AM диска, например, какое значение было у диска (80 ч?).

Его можно было бы выключить - но выключать нет смысла, поэтому такой опции нет.
Вообще, если функция вообще поддерживается жестким диском (опция есть в Информационном странице и в меню «Диск»), то жесткий диск всегда использует его. Просто если отключить - то автоматически используются настройки по умолчанию, рекомендованные заводом-изготовителем.

Как вы можете видеть на странице информации и в маленьком окне, где можно настроить параметр, Hard Disk Sentinel автоматически отображает рекомендованное производителем значение (по умолчанию), как показано на этом изображении:

Поэтому, если вы установите уровень по умолчанию, он будет иметь такой же эффект, как если бы вы его отключили.

Для всех настроек программа автоматически отображает значение этого значения, например:

80ч = мин. производительность и громкость
FEh = макс. производительность и объем

и все значения между ними сбалансированы производительность/объем, если они реализованы. Многие жесткие диски используют только два вышеупомянутых уровня, установка промежуточного уровня автоматически переключается на один из вышеупомянутых уровней.

Вы можете использовать меню «Диск» -> «Проверка случайного поиска», чтобы проверить производительность времени поиска (поскольку акустическое управление обычно влияет на скорость и «шум» поиска) и уровни шума в текущих настройках. Затем вы можете решить, какой параметр будет для вас оптимальным: например, если вы видите более высокую производительность (и минимальное увеличение уровня шума), вы можете использовать параметр FEh.

Согласно опыту, это может быть более интересно на старых жестких дисках, где шум (обычно шум поиска) был намного выше, чем у современных жестких дисков. Некоторые новые современные жесткие диски по-прежнему имеют эту функцию, и значение можно регулировать, но эффект незначителен, трудно определить разницу между настройкой Min / Max (как с точки зрения производительности, так и уровня шума).
Вот почему большинство современных жестких дисков больше не имеют этой функции, а функция управления акустикой недоступна в меню «Диск».

Спасибо за объяснение. Да, я обнаружил, что любые различия в производительности/шуме незначительны независимо от минимального или максимального значения.

Приношу свои извинения за возрождение этой темы, но мне показалось, что это подходящее место для добавления моего вопроса. На снимке экрана, который вы разместили, есть строка «Автоматическая настройка параметров при перезапуске». Что означает этот параметр? Я погуглил, но ничего не нашел. По моему опыту, новая акустическая настройка сразу же применяется, когда я нажимаю кнопку «Настроить». Этот новый параметр сохраняется после перезагрузки. Поэтому мне интересно, для чего предназначена опция «Автоматическая настройка параметров при перезапуске».

Заранее спасибо за ответ.

> "Автоматическая настройка параметров при перезапуске". Что означает этот параметр?

Как правило, когда мы настраиваем функцию/особенность жестких дисков, например настройку акустического управления (но это верно и для других функций, таких как расширенное управление питанием и чувствительность управления свободным падением — если они также поддерживаются), жесткий диск диск должен сохранить этот параметр и использовать его даже после выключения/выключения питания.

Но на самом деле это обычно НЕ соответствует действительности, жесткие диски автоматически сбрасывают настройки до значений по умолчанию при полном цикле включения питания (при выключении).

В этом случае помогает параметр «Автоматическая настройка параметров при перезапуске»: если он включен, то при повторном запуске системы (и Hard Disk Sentinel) Hard Disk Sentinel проверяет, сброшено ли значение. Если это так, он автоматически устанавливает значение снова, поэтому нет необходимости настраивать его вручную при каждой перезагрузке.

Спасибо за быстрый ответ! Это проясняет ситуацию. Может быть, стоит включить информацию из этой ветки и в справочные тексты. Конечно, сначала я посмотрел туда, но некоторая информация в этой ветке (включая ваш ответ на мой вопрос) там отсутствует.

Еще раз спасибо, также за ОТЛИЧНУЮ программу! (очень довольный пользователь Pro более 5 лет!)

Спасибо за ваше сообщение, добрые слова и предложение!
Честно говоря, да, в настоящее время мы изучаем справку и добавляем дополнительную информацию о некоторых опциях/функциях (таких как эта), добавленных за эти годы. , так как исходная справка создана

Читайте также: